# Break-Glass: Catalog Cache Invalidation

Scope: the Pinrow product catalog at Veldstone Retail. If stale prices persist after a purge and the Hollowmere invalidation queue is wedged, use break-glass to flush the edge tier directly. Contractors: get verbal sign-off from the catalog lead first. Steps: open the Hollowmere admin shell, select emergency-flush, confirm the tenant, and run it once — repeated flushes thrash the origin. Access is logged and expires after 20 minutes. Unseal the admin shell with the passphrase below.

recovery phrase for kahop-tajog: istix-casvan

## Service Accounts — Snapshot Testing

The Pinefold snapshot suite renders UI components headlessly and uploads baseline images to the Verity store. Uploads require the dedicated snapshot service account, never a personal login, so diffs stay attributable to CI runs. Configure your local runner with the account's key shown below.

service key, fawip-bajef: kto11_Qt5wZK9vdNC

**Q: Where is the mail room now?**

A: The mail room moved last month from Level 1 to the rear annexe of Foxden Place, behind the loading bay. Outgoing post must be dropped off by 15:30 for same-day collection. Incoming parcels are shelved alphabetically by surname. The annexe door stays locked outside collection hours, so you'll need the keypad code to get in, which is:

door code, yagap-bahof: bdg-O-05

Migration step 4: Archive cold storage buckets. Stop the Frostvault sweeper before starting. Tag each bucket with its retention class, then run the archiver in dry-run mode and verify the manifest. Only then execute the real pass. Buckets older than 18 months move to glacier tier; the rest stay. The archiver reads these settings at startup.

service settings:
PRAIX_LOG_LEVEL=error
PRAIX_METRICS_HOST=metrics.praix.qorvelcorp.corp
PRAIX_POOL_SIZE=16